See below ingredients and instructions of the recipe
c Butter; softened
1/4 c Shortening
2 c Sugar
5 Eggs
3 c All-purpose flour
1 ts Baking powder
1/2 ts Baking soda
1/2 ts Salt
c Butter milk
1 ts Vanilla extract
1/2 ts Lemon extract
Frosting:
1/2 c Butter or margarine; softene
3 tb Orange juice
3 tb Lemon juice
2 tb Orange peel; grated
2 tb Lemon peel; grated
1 ts Lemon extract
5 1/2 c Confectioners' sugar
Recipe by: Taste of Home In a mixing bowl, cream butter, shortening
and sugar until light and fluffy. Add eggs, one at a time beating
well after each addition. Combine dry ingredients: add to creamed
mixture alternately with buttermilk, beginning and ending with dry
ingredients. Stir in extracts. Pour into three greased and floured
9-in, cake pans. Bake at 350 deg. for 25-30 minutes or until cakes
test done. Cool for 10 minutes in pans before removing to wire racks
to cool completely. For frosting, beat butter in a mixing bowl until
fluffy; add the next five ingredients and mix well. Gradually add
confectioners' sugar; beat until frosting has desired spreading
consistency. Spread between layers and over the top and sides of
cake. Yield: 10-12 servings
